I have a website in PHP where users can login/register.
I have just uploaded the PHP laravel code to the server with LAMP and Postfix, but the PHP code can't use the postfix to send email to users.
Postfix itself works fine via the terminal/command or the mail agants.
So it is an integration problem between the PHP and postfix which needs solution.
This is the PHP error I get:
postfix/smtpd[20968]: warning: connect # to subsystem /var/spool/postfix/private/proxymap: Permission denied
